Forming an electoral alliance for JHL’s Union Council elections 2027
Nomination of candidates for JHL’s Union Council elections opens in October 2026. You can form an electoral alliance now, and it only requires two candidates.
Trade Union JHL will organise Union Council elections in February–March 2027. The Union Council is Trade Union JHL’s highest decision-making body.
Nomination of Union Council candidates begins in October 2026. All JHL members who meet the requirements can become candidates.
Candidates can join an electoral alliance or stand for election without an alliance.
An electoral alliance can be formed by a minimum of two JHL members who are candidates in the same electoral district.
Trade Union JHL has informed the parties represented in the Finnish Parliament of its Union Council elections and of forming electoral alliances.
Important dates for forming an electoral alliance
- If you want your electoral alliance to be in JHL’s elections system when nomination of candidates begins, the electoral alliance must be formed at the latest by 5 October 2026.
- Information on a formed electoral alliance must be delivered to the Central Elections Committee at the latest on 11 December 2026 by midnight.
How can I form an electoral alliance or join one?
- You can form an electoral alliance by filling in an electronic form (in Finnish) available on JHL’s Material Bank.
- Electoral alliances can be based on political parties or formed around a specific cause.
- Electoral alliances can cover the whole country or a specific electoral district.
- Forming an electoral alliance requires a minimum of two candidates who stand for election in the same electoral district.
- If an electoral alliance has been formed by 5 October 2026, it will be included as an option in JHL’s elections system when nomination of candidates begins.
- A candidate can join an electoral alliance that is available in JHL’s elections system.
- If an electoral alliance is not in the system, it is the responsibility of each electoral alliance’s representatives to take care that those who want to join the electoral alliance are able to do so.
